Fae and Fare: The Wandering Inn Series, Book 2
This book was better than Book One. The main protagonists are no longer insufferable; the plot is decent. One of the downsides to books published episodically like this is that it just doesn't have the best structure. The story just goes on and on and on. So it doesn't have the climax and the denouement. But it's still fun. I'm torn, maybe someday I'll read book 3 but the problem is it's not necessarily super compelling and I expect it would be similar to book 2 which was fine and I had no regrets reading it.
